Hilton teams up with Les Roches Jin Jiang
02 December 2011Chinese hospitality management school Les Roches Jin Jiang International Hotel Management College (LRJJ) has partnered with Hilton Worldwide on a new training initiative.
Under the partnership, 20 top first-year students will be selected by both Hilton Worldwide and LRJJ every year. Each of the students will be offered three full-time internships at one of Hilton’s properties throughout their course, thus giving them 18 months of training at the hotel group in total.
In addition, Hilton Worldwide will organize guest lectures, on-site visits and e-learning programs specially designed to prepare the students for the workplace.
"Hilton Worldwide is excited to impart our expertise to nurture young talent for China's growing hospitality industry. The Hilton Class program is part of our commitment to extend and deepen our presence in China. We believe it will not only benefit the industry, but also provide Hilton Worldwide access to best-in-class talent to support our ambitious goal of expanding from the current over 20 to more than 100 hotels over the next five years," said Dave Osborne, senior vice president, HR Operations and Development, Hilton Worldwide.
"The Hilton Class offers our students an exciting opportunity to be trained by one of the biggest and most well-recognised names in the industry - Hilton Worldwide. Beyond that, the collaboration also keeps both our faculty and students up-to-date with the latest requirements and trends of the industry. We are confident the program will better prepare our students for the workplace and enhance the employment opportunities available to them upon graduation," added Judy Hou, CEO of LRJJ.
